45 #define NCACHE 64 /* power of 2 */
46 #define MASK NCACHE - 1 /* bits to store with */
47
48 char *
49 user_from_uid(uid, nouser)
50 uid_t uid;
51 int nouser;
52 {
53 static struct ncache {
54 uid_t uid;
55 char name[UT_NAMESIZE + 1];
56 } c_uid[NCACHE];
57 static int pwopen;
58 static char nbuf[15]; /* 32 bits == 10 digits */
59 register struct passwd *pw;
60 register struct ncache *cp;
61
62 cp = c_uid + (uid & MASK);
63 if (cp->uid != uid || !*cp->name) {
64 if (pwopen == 0) {
65 setpassent(1);
66 pwopen = 1;
67 }
68 if ((pw = getpwuid(uid)) == NULL) {
69 if (nouser)
70 return (NULL);
71 (void)snprintf(nbuf, sizeof(nbuf), "%u", uid);
72 return (nbuf);
73 }
74 cp->uid = uid;
75 (void)strncpy(cp->name, pw->pw_name, UT_NAMESIZE);
76 cp->name[UT_NAMESIZE] = '\0';
77 }
78 return (cp->name);
79 }
80
81 char *
82 group_from_gid(gid, nogroup)
83 gid_t gid;
84 int nogroup;
85 {
86 static struct ncache {
87 gid_t gid;
88 char name[UT_NAMESIZE + 1];
89 } c_gid[NCACHE];
90 static int gropen;
91 static char nbuf[15]; /* 32 bits == 10 digits */
92 struct group *gr;
93 struct ncache *cp;
94
95 cp = c_gid + (gid & MASK);
96 if (cp->gid != gid || !*cp->name) {
97 if (gropen == 0) {
98 setgroupent(1);
99 gropen = 1;
100 }
101 if ((gr = getgrgid(gid)) == NULL) {
102 if (nogroup)
103 return (NULL);
104 (void)snprintf(nbuf, sizeof(nbuf), "%u", gid);
105 return (nbuf);
106 }
107 cp->gid = gid;
108 (void)strncpy(cp->name, gr->gr_name, UT_NAMESIZE);
109 cp->name[UT_NAMESIZE] = '\0';
110 }
111 return (cp->name);
112 }
